About

Khalid Atiq Bilal Readymade Garments Trading Co. – fashion apparel for women and teenagers in Deira, Dubai. Open daily.

Khalid Atiq Bilal Readymade Garments Trading Co. supplies fashion apparel for teenagers and women in Deira's Al Daghaya area. Located on 42 Street, the store accepts cash payments and operates daily from 09:00 to 23:00, with Friday hours from 09:00–12:00 and 14:00–23:00.
